To: Dispatch Desk. Subject: Contract transfer, today. Three signed contracts for the Ostervale acquisition need to move from the Brindlemoor office to Legal at Carrow House before 4 p.m. Original signatures only — no scans, no copies en route. Sealed envelope, already prepared, sitting with reception at Brindlemoor. Use a vetted courier, not the pool run. Legal has been notified and will be waiting. No detours, no combined runs. The courier must be given the following confidential instruction at hand-over:

handover note for yagef-bagep: the drudor pelius courier leaves the kasdor zorvan norir ledger at gate 8016 under passcode 755406

# PodLint env file — validates the Quillcast and Murmurline feeds nightly.
# Maintainers: keep FEED_TIMEOUT_SECONDS under 120 or the batch runner
# will overlap with the morning sync. VALIDATOR_STRICT_MODE toggles
# enclosure checks; leave it on unless triaging a backlog.
# The validator authenticates to the feed registry with a credential,
# which is set on the line directly below.

vault entry, yahif-yajep: COURIER_KEY29=b802bdf8034096b65a51c6ba5abe2

Ticket GIV-218: The donation-receipt mailer in the Heartleaf staging cluster was pointed at the production SMTP relay, so test receipts went to real donors. We've since isolated staging behind the Fernwick relay and scrubbed the queue. Future maintainers: verify the relay host before each deploy. The staging env file must include the mailer signing credential on the line immediately following this note.

env line for fafof-fahag: LEDGER_TOKEN5=f8790

# Gridsmith clue-fill engine.
# Plugin authors: the solver's backtracking budget and word-score
# cutoffs live here, not in your plugin config. Raising the budget
# gives denser grids but fill time grows fast past 15x15. If your
# plugin supplies a custom dictionary, retune rather than guess.
# The module constants are:

limits module of tafof-kagef:
RATE_LIMITS = {
    "zorix": 10,
    "ralath": 1,
    "quenwyn": 2,
    "holael": 10,
}